How does TruBridge operate?

TruBridge, Inc. is a healthcare solutions company focused on improving the financial and operational performance of healthcare providers, especially community and rural hospitals. The company reported $87.2 million in revenue for Q1 2025, a 4% increase from the previous year.

How Does TruBridge Company Work?

TruBridge offers a suite of services including revenue cycle management, strategic consulting, and managed IT. Their expertise helps healthcare organizations manage billing, collections, and technology effectively.

TruBridge helps hospitals by streamlining their financial operations.

What Are the Key Operations Driving TruBridge’s Success?

TruBridge company provides essential business and technology solutions specifically for healthcare organizations, with a strong focus on community and rural hospitals. Their core offerings are divided into two main areas: Financial Health and Patient Care, aiming to improve both the financial stability and the patient experience for their clients.

Icon Financial Health Solutions

This segment, which represented 64% of TruBridge's revenue in Q1 2025, is dedicated to optimizing healthcare providers' financial performance. It encompasses a full range of revenue cycle management (RCM) services designed to speed up revenue collection, minimize errors, and boost cash flow.

Icon Patient Care Technology

The Patient Care segment offers Electronic Health Records (EHR) solutions and related services for various healthcare settings. This includes integrating data across different care environments to ensure efficient patient management and improved patient engagement.

Icon Revenue Cycle Management Excellence

TruBridge's revenue cycle management services include crucial functions like estimating patient liability, managing contracts, and scrubbing claims before submission. Their Complete Business Office (CBO) solution is designed to significantly enhance financial outcomes, aiming for over a 13% increase in cash collections and up to a 24% reduction in accounts receivable days.

Icon Operational Efficiency and Technology Integration

The company leverages technology development, including AI and automation, within its financial health workflows to boost efficiency and cost-effectiveness. To further improve profit margins, TruBridge has been transitioning its Financial Health CBO client base offshore, with approximately 30% moved by early 2025 and a goal to reach 60% by the end of the year.

How Does TruBridge Make Money?

TruBridge company generates its income from two main areas: Financial Health and Patient Care. The majority of its earnings come from ongoing services, with recurring revenue making up 94% of its total income in the first quarter of 2025, showing a consistent financial performance.

Icon

Financial Health Segment Dominance

The Financial Health segment is the main source of revenue for TruBridge. In Q1 2025, it brought in $56.1 million, which is 64% of the company's total earnings. This segment saw a 5% increase compared to the previous year.

Icon

Patient Care Segment Growth

The Patient Care segment, which includes Electronic Health Records (EHR) and patient engagement tools, also contributed to the company's revenue. It generated $31.1 million in Q1 2025, showing a modest 1% increase year-over-year.

Icon

Overall Revenue Performance

For the first quarter of 2025, TruBridge reported a total revenue of $87.2 million. This is a 4% increase from the $84.1 million earned in the same period of 2024, indicating steady growth.

Icon

Annual Revenue Projections

Looking ahead to the full year 2025, TruBridge anticipates its total revenue to be between $345 million and $360 million. This projection reflects the company's confidence in its ongoing business strategies.

Icon

Shift in Bookings Reporting

To offer a clearer financial picture, TruBridge has changed how it reports bookings. It now uses Annual Contract Value (ACV) instead of Total Contract Value (TCV). This provides a more transparent view of expected revenue over a twelve-month span.

Which Strategic Decisions Have Shaped TruBridge’s Business Model?

TruBridge has strategically evolved, marked by a significant rebranding from CPSI to TruBridge on March 4, 2024. This transition underscored a refined focus on its comprehensive financial and clinical solutions, capitalizing on the established strength of the TruBridge brand.

Icon Key Milestones and Strategic Shifts

The company's operational strategy emphasizes efficiency and cost reduction. A notable initiative involves the offshore transition of its Financial Health Complete Business Office (CBO) clients, with a target of 60% offshore support by the end of 2025. This move, coupled with AI-driven workflow automation, aims to further decrease labor expenses and bolster gross margins, which reached 54.7% in Q1 2025.

Icon Divestiture and Streamlining

In 2024, TruBridge completed its first divestiture by selling American HealthTech (AHT). This action signifies a strategic effort to streamline its business units and concentrate on core offerings.

Icon Competitive Strengths in Healthcare RCM

TruBridge's competitive edge is built on several pillars. Its specialized focus on community and rural hospitals allows for highly tailored solutions and a deep understanding of their unique operational challenges, leading to strong client satisfaction in this niche.

Icon Industry Recognition and Technological Advancement

The company's suite of revenue cycle management (RCM) offerings has earned HFMA Peer Reviewed® status, indicating industry-wide recognition for quality. Furthermore, TruBridge's leadership in technology, particularly its integration of AI and automation into RCM processes, provides a significant advantage in optimizing billing, reducing claim denials, and lowering operational costs.

Icon

Client Retention and Future Adaptability

A strong commitment to client retention is a key differentiator for TruBridge. The company boasts a 98% retention rate within its Patient Care segment (excluding Centriq) and high renewal rates for its Financial Health clients in Q1 2025. TruBridge continues to adapt to evolving market trends through ongoing investments in innovation and operational enhancements, including a centralized workplace strategy and new leadership within its Financial Health division.

How Is TruBridge Positioning Itself for Continued Success?

TruBridge holds a strong market position in healthcare solutions, especially for community and rural hospitals. A 2025 Black Book user survey highlighted TruBridge's leadership in client satisfaction among small and rural providers, attributing this to intuitive workflows, quick training, robust customer support, and a tangible impact on revenue capture. This specialization allows TruBridge to effectively serve a vital segment of the healthcare market that is often overlooked by larger, more general providers.

Icon Industry Position

TruBridge is a leader in healthcare solutions for community and rural hospitals. In a 2025 survey, they led in client satisfaction for small and rural providers.

Icon Key Strengths

Clients cite intuitive workflows, rapid training, and strong customer support as key benefits. The company demonstrates a measurable impact on revenue capture for its clients.

Icon Identified Risks

The company faces risks from healthcare funding uncertainties and policy changes like Medicare expansion. Rising operational costs and workforce shortages also present challenges.

Icon Future Outlook & Strategy

For 2025, the company projects revenue between $345 million and $360 million. Strategic focuses include enhancing customer satisfaction, optimizing operations, and expanding the sales pipeline.

Icon

Strategic Initiatives for Growth

TruBridge is investing in offshore capabilities, aiming for 60% of its global workforce to support clients by the end of 2025. The company is also leveraging AI for revenue cycle improvements and exploring expansion into the 100 to 400-bed hospital market.
